Museum is really nice building. If you are going from highway, best way is from A81, exit S. Zentrum und S. Zuffenhausen. It is about 700 m into town. Factory tours are limited to 15 people and operate only twice per day, Monday through Friday. They are often filled two months in advance and during peak season, four months in advance according to PCNA.
